Excerpt from De la Culture du Murier
France. On doit croire que sa culture aurait déjà acquis tout le développement qu'elle prend aujourd'hui si l'incertitude d'obtenir des récoltes de soie satisfaisantes n'eût affaibli le zèle d'un grand nombre de cultivateurs ils attribuèrent au climat et à la terre des accidens qui appartenaient à l'ignorance, et 'ils portèrent la hache aux pieds de ces arbres qui devaient les enrichir.
